nombre: paola zenteno canelas. plataforma multi agente para el mejoramiento de procesos utilizando...

13
Nombre: Paola Zenteno Canelas

Upload: eutimio-arguello

Post on 06-Feb-2015

11 views

Category:

Documents


4 download

TRANSCRIPT

Page 1: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

Nombre: Paola Zenteno Canelas

Page 2: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

Page 3: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

1.- INTRODUCCION

2.- ¿QUE ES UNA BUSINESS PROCESS MANAGEMENT

(BPM)?

3.- TECNOLOGIAS BPM

4.- ¿QUE SON LOS SISTEMAS MULTI AGENTES (SMA)?

5.- ¿QUE SON LAS ONTOLOGIAS?

6.- ARQUITECTURA DE UNA SMA

7.- CONCLUSIONES

8.- BIBLIOGRAFIA

Page 4: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

Introducción

En este artículo se presenta una revisión del estado del arte y de

otros trabajos similares de las tecnologías Business Process

Management BPM, Sistemas Multi Agentes y Ontologías. Se propone

el diseño de un sistema multi agente como complemento a las

funcionalidades de las tecnologías BPM, cuyo objetivo es facilitar el

mejoramiento continuo las Pequeña y Mediana Empresa, que tiene

un enfoque de negocio hacia procesos. El Sistema Multia gente

recibe como hechos información de las empresas y de sus procesos

de negocios, los cuales son validados

y se razona sobre ellos para identificar sus elementos comunes y

nuevos cambios y comprobar su semántica con respecto a una

Ontología.

Page 5: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

BUSINESS PROCESS MANAGEMENT

Una de las alternativas que tienen las empresas para alcanzar la

diferenciación y por tanto, una ventaja competitiva, es la eficiencia

operacional, innovando en sus modelos y procesos de negocio

apoyándose en las Tecnologías de Información y Comunicación (TIC). Es

así, como se consolida BPM (Business Process Management), como una

estrategia que permite apoyar los continuos cambios que sufren los

procesos en cuanto a la utilización de nuevos modelos de mercados,

tecnologías y plataformas computacionales, y la aparición de nuevos

participantes en el negocio. BPM permite la modelación y el control de

procesos de negocio, lo que favorece las oportunidades de automatizar

tareas o eliminar las innecesarias, facilitando la interoperablidad con el

cliente externo y su completa satisfacción. proporcionando visibilidad y

control de procesos.

Page 6: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

TECNOLOGIAS BPM

Un BPMS contiene como mínimo los siguientes componentes:

a)BPMN (Business Process Modeling Notation), un editor gráfico que

soporta una notación para el modelamiento de procesos.

b)BPEL (Business Process Execution Language), un lenguaje

especifico que interpreta la notación BPMN para el desarrollo y

definición de procesos,

c)Un motor de ejecución, el cual ejecuta los procesos escritos y

además permiten realizar el seguimiento de tareas y la integración

con sistemas externos al negocio.

Page 7: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

SISTEMAS MULTI AGENTES(SMA)

Los Sistemas Multi Agentes (SMA) surgieron como una nueva área de

investigación en los años 90, desarrollándose desde los campos del

procesamiento distribuido y la inteligencia artificial. Los SMA contienen

agentes que interactúan a través del paso de mensajes, son capaces de

interactuar con el entorno y tienen diferentes “esferas” de influencia. La

construcción de SMA integra tecnologías de distintas áreas de

conocimiento: técnicas de ingeniería del software para estructurar el

proceso de desarrollo; técnicas de inteligencia artificial para dotar a los

programas de capacidad para tratar situaciones imprevistas y tomar

decisiones, y programación concurrente y distribuida para tratar la

coordinación de tareas ejecutadas en diferentes máquinas. Las

plataformas de desarrollo dan soluciones al modelado de

comportamiento y a la coordinación de agentes, proporcionan servicios

básicos como gestión de agentes, librerías de algoritmos, localización y

movilidad de agentes .

Page 8: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

Modelos DE los sistemas multi agentes

Son los siguientes:

1)Modelo de arquitectura de la organización de agentes.

2)Modelo de Tareas.

3)Modelo de comunicación de agentes.

4)Modelo de Recursos.

5)Modelo de Agentes

Page 9: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

ONTOLOGIAS

El concepto de Ontología toma importancia también en este

trabajo y se define como: “una taxonomía de conceptos con

atributos y relaciones, que proporcionan un vocabulario

consensuado para definir redes semánticas de unidades de

información interrelacionadas”. Su uso más común lo

encontramos en la inteligencia artificial y en la representación

del conocimiento. Los programas informáticos pueden utilizar las

ontologías para propósitos como el razonamiento inductivo, la

clasificación, y una variedad de técnicas de resolución de

problemas. Existen varios campos de aplicación como el

comercio electrónico, gestión del conocimiento corporativo,

búsqueda de información en la web, enseñanza, librerías

digitales y turismo.

Page 10: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ES
Page 11: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

CONCLUSIONES

Aunque las tecnologías para el desarrollo de agentes se encuentran

aun en revisión y maduración, y la mayoría de las metodologías no

ofrecen ejemplos de aplicación, la metodología UPSAM permitió

mostrar el sistema a través de diferentes modelos y el interés

principal de su selección fue aplicarla para validarla y mostrar su

utilidad.

Como futuro aporte se presentará el detalle la construcción de la

ontología de negocios utilizando una metodología basada en

tareas, y además se probará la plataforma con los procesos de

negocios de las empresas que tengan sistemas de calidad bajo ISO

9001, de tal forma que empresas PYMES puedan mantener sus

sistemas de calidad con la colaboración de otras empresas, y lograr

el mejoramiento continuo exigido en el enfoque hacia procesos.

Page 12: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

BIBLIOGRAFIA

Castillo, A., 2002. Modelos y Plataformas de Agentes Software Móviles e Inteligentes para Gestión del Conocimiento en el Contexto de las Tecnologías de la Información. DoctoralThesis. Universidad Pontificia de Salamanca Campus Madrid.

Havey M., Essential Business Process Modeling, 2005,O’Reilly

Page 13: Nombre: Paola Zenteno Canelas. Plataforma Multi Agente para el Mejoramiento de Procesos Utilizando Tecnologías BPM y Ontologías para las PYMES

GRACIAS…